848. Tim Scott (R)C 5.5 [Open Full Bio →]

U.S. Senator SC 2013-present (appointed by Haley to fill DeMint vacancy + elected 2014 + 2016 + 2022) · U.S. Representative SC-1 2011-2013 · SC State House 2009-2010 · First Black senator from the South since Reconstruction · 2024 VP shortlist (Vance picked)
M01M02M03M04M05M06M07M08M09M10M11M12M13M14M15
66776656665767

Strengths: M14 + M12 substantive 14-year Senate institutional track record; M07 sustained engagement on Opportunity Zones + criminal-justice-reform (First Step Act 2018 co-author). Drag: M02 + M07 sub-Severe — May 2024 Meet the Press refused to answer 'will you accept the 2024 election results' direct question 3 times; sub-Severe institutional drift but not criterion-class.
